Top Questions and Answers

Key components of a Florida lease agreement Parties involved: landlord and tenant. ... Property description. ... Terms of lease: Duration, rent, and payment. ... Security deposit: Amount and conditions for return. ... Maintenance and repair responsibilities. ... Other specific clauses.
